In Nashville during the mid-1950s confidence man Reynolds has been getting even with a large oil company by robbing gas stations. A thief with a heart, Reynolds always gives part of the take back to the underpaid attendants, his philosophy being that they are getting pennies while the
oil companies are raking in an absurd amount of money. When pursuit gets too intense, in the form of Carney as a detective-evangelist, Reynolds becomes the manager of a struggling country music band. Through his manipulative abilities Reynolds lands the band a gig at the Grand Ole Opry, himself
